的工作过程,已经晓得了怎么编写React组件,知道了React的数据流,那么是时候学习React组件的生命周期了,每个组件都包含生命周期方法,生命周期如同四季更替,一个人的生,老,病,死.在每个特殊的年龄阶段...,做着不同的事情
在React编写组件中,每个组件在网页中都有被创建,更新,删除这么一过程,就像有机的生命体一样
理解生命周期函数对于编写React组件代码是非常重要的
如果你不清楚生命周期,以及生命周期的应用场景...(unmount): 组件从DOM中删除的过程
componentWillUnmount: 组件从页面销毁时,会触发该函数,当需要对数据进行清理时,例如定时器的清理,放到该函数里面去做
三种不同的过程,...,例如:Ajax数据获取,则放到componentDidMount中
render:组件的渲染,插入到DOM元素中,
componentDidMount:组件挂载完之后调用,也就是在render函数之后调用...,常用于组件的启动工作,例如:Ajax数据的获取,定时器的启动
当然数据的请求最好放在componentDidMount函数中,而当props或者state发生改变时,会引起组件的渲染,也就是组件的更新